Juliana trails = [tex]3\frac{2}{3}[/tex]

Brody trails = [tex]2\frac{5}{6}[/tex].

In order to find total how far they hiked, we need to add Juliana trails and Brody trails.

Juliana trails + Brody trails  = [tex]3\frac{2}{3} +2\frac{5}{6}[/tex].

Adding whole number in front 3+2 = 5.

Now, adding fractions 2/3 and 5/6 by taking common denominator (lcd).

Least common denominator(lcd) of 3 and 6 is = 6.

So, we need to make both denominator = 6.

Muilplying 2/3 by 2 in top and bottom we get 2*2/3*2 = 4/6.

Now, adding 4/6 and 5/6.

We got the common denominator 6. So, we can just add numerators.

[tex]\frac{4}{6} +\frac{5}{6}  = \frac{4+5}{6} = \frac{9}{6}[/tex]

Converting 9/6 into improper fraction:

If we divide 9 by 6, we get quotent 1 and 3 remainder.

So, we get fraction [tex]1 \frac{3}{6} .[/tex]

3/6 could also be reduced to 1/2 by dividing 3 and 6 by 3.

We get,

[tex]\frac{3}{6}  = \frac{1}{2}[/tex]

Therefore, [tex]1 \frac{3}{6}  = 1 \frac{1}{2}[/tex]

Adding 5 into [tex]1\frac{1}{2}[/tex].

We get,

[tex]6\frac{1}{2}.[/tex]

So, we could say

They hiked total [tex]6\frac{1}{2}[/tex] far.
